⚡ FEIE vs Foreign Tax Credit Optimizer
The most important decision for most expats — we calculate both scenarios instantly
How it works: FEIE excludes up to $126,500 of foreign earned income from US tax. Foreign Tax Credit gives you a dollar-for-dollar credit for taxes paid to foreign governments. The optimal choice depends on your country's tax rate.

FinCEN 114 (FBAR) is due April 15 (auto-extended to October 15). Penalties: up to $10,000/year per account non-willful · up to 50% of balance willful. File even if no tax is owed.
💰 Threshold Check
FBAR required if aggregate foreign account balance exceeded $10,000 at any point in the year

Streamlined Procedures allow US expats who missed filings to catch up — with zero penalty under SFOP. Eligibility requires non-willful conduct and IRS must not have contacted you yet.

Form W-7 is filed by your non-US spouse to obtain an Individual Taxpayer Identification Number (ITIN). Attach it to the front of your Form 1040. Processing takes 7 weeks — file early.
